Point shader-lab at a binary that starts both transports
shader-lab is introduced as the umbrella lab target, but it is wired to src/bin/serve.rs, whose main only launches the Axum HTTP server; it never starts the tonic gRPC server path. In practice, running cargo run --features lab --bin shader-lab enables gRPC dependencies but exposes only REST, so any workflow expecting gRPC from the new single lab binary will fail at runtime.
